I just spoke to agent at front desk. She showed me the floor plans. She said both Napili and Lahaina towers are essentially the same, but with different views at the ends.

For Napili tower, room x31 (stairs) and x33 are separate, but can be connected together. x33 is the oceanfront suite since it is the closest to the ocean. Suite x34 is considered ocean view suite since it is not right at the ocean front. Each floor has one ocean front suite and one ocean view suite.

For Lahaina tower, suite x79 is configured as a Deluxe oceanfront suite. Suite x80 is the ocean view suite since it is not right at the ocean front. So each floor has one Deluxe oceanfront suite and one ocean view suite.

But a lot of the rooms can be connected and changed to new configuration.
